Specifically: «» are nestable non-escaping string delimiters (IE «foo «bar»» reads as "foo «bar»"), 「」 are like «» but wrapped so 「foo bar」 produces (#%cjk-corner-quotes "foo bar"), foo bar﴿ reads as (#%ornate-parens foo bar), ⦓foo bar⦔ reads as (#%inequality-brackets foo bar), ⦕foo bar⦖ reads as (#%double-inequality-brackets foo bar), 🌜foo bar🌛 reads as (#%moon-faces foo bar), and ⟅foo bar⟆ reads as (#%s-shaped-bag-delim foo bar).
